Selective evasion of Ukraine news was greatest in many of the nations closest to the conflict, strengthening searchings for from our added survey in 2015, right after the war had actually started. Our information might not suggest a lack of interest in Ukraine from nearby nations but rather a desire to manage time or safeguard mental health from the really real horrors of battle.
Comparing Finland with a politically polarised country such as the USA (see next graph) that is less impacted by the battle, we find an extremely different pattern of topic evasion. In the USA, we discover that customers are most likely to avoid subjects such as nationwide politics and social justice, where arguments over concerns such as sex, sexuality, and race have come to be very politicised.
American national politics are rather poisonous these days. I discover sometimes that I have to detach from stories that just make me upset. F, explanation 61, United States For some people, bitter and divisive political discussions are a factor to turn off news entirely, however for some political upholders, avoidance is usually concerning blocking out viewpoints you don't intend to listen to.

Throughout markets, general trust fund in information (40%) and trust fund in the sources individuals utilize themselves (46%) are down by a further 2 percent factors this year.
Undoubtedly, with the rear-view mirror, the COVID-19 count on bump is plainly visible in the following graph, though the direction of travel afterwards has actually been blended. In many cases (e.g. Finland), the trust fund boost has actually been kept, while in others the upturn browse around here looks more like a blip in a tale of continued long-lasting decrease.
Some of the highest possible reported levels of media objection are discovered in countries with highest degree of suspect, such as Greece, the Philippines, the USA, France, and the UK. The cheapest levels of media criticism frequent those with higher levels of trust, such as Finland, Norway, Denmark, and Japan.

This year we asked participants concerning their preferences for message, sound and video clip when taking in news online. Usually, we discover that the majority still like to check out the news (57%), instead than watch (30%) or pay attention to it (13%), yet more youthful individuals (under-35s) are more probable to listen (17%) than older groups.
Behind the averages we find substantial and shocking nation differences. In markets with a solid reading custom, such as Finland and the United Kingdom, around eight in ten still prefer to review online information, however in India and Thailand, around four in ten (40%) say they like to see news online, and in the Philippines that percentage mores than half (52%).
